Optimization-based robot compliance control: Geometric and linear quadratic approaches

被引:35
作者
Matinfar, M [1 ]
Hashtrudi-Zaad, K [1 ]
机构
[1] Queens Univ, Dept Elect & Comp Engn, Kingston, ON, Canada
关键词
robot compliance control; robot impedance control; quadratic optimal control;
D O I
10.1177/0278364905056347
中图分类号
TP24 [机器人技术];
学科分类号
080202 ; 1405 ;
摘要
Impedance control is a compliance control strategy capable of accommodating both unconstrained and constrained motions. The performance of impedance controllers depends heavily upon environment dynamics and the choice of target impedance. To maintain performance for a wide range of environments, target impedance needs to be adjusted adaptively. In this paper a geometric view on impedance control is developed for stiff environments, resulting in a "static-optimized" controller that minimizes a combined generalized position and force trajectory error metric. To incorporate the dynamic nature of the manipulator-environment system, a new cost function is considered. A classic quadratic optimal control strategy is employed to design a novel adaptive compliance controller with control parameters adjusted based upon environment stiffness and damping. In steady state, the proposed controller ultimately implements the static-optimized impedance controller. Simulation and experimental results indicate that the proposed optimal controller offers smoother transient response and a better trade-off between position and force regulation.
引用
收藏
页码:645 / 656
页数:12
相关论文
共 20 条
[1]   HYBRID IMPEDANCE CONTROL OF ROBOTIC MANIPULATORS [J].
ANDERSON, RJ ;
SPONG, MW .
IEEE JOURNAL OF ROBOTICS AND AUTOMATION, 1988, 4 (05) :549-556
[2]  
BRYSON AE, 1998, DYNAMIC OPTIMIZATION
[3]   A survey of robot interaction control schemes with experimental comparison [J].
Chiaverini, S ;
Siciliano, B ;
Villani, L .
IEEE-ASME TRANSACTIONS ON MECHATRONICS, 1999, 4 (03) :273-285
[4]   Optimal selection of manipulator impedance for contact tasks [J].
DiMaio, SP ;
Hashtrudi-Zaad, K ;
Salcudean, SE .
2004 IEEE INTERNATIONAL CONFERENCE ON ROBOTICS AND AUTOMATION, VOLS 1- 5, PROCEEDINGS, 2004, :4795-4801
[5]  
DIMAIO SP, 2000, ASME INT MECH ENG C, V69, P1223
[6]   Variable damping impedance control of a bilateral telerobotic system [J].
Dubey, RV ;
Chan, TF ;
Everett, SE .
IEEE CONTROL SYSTEMS MAGAZINE, 1997, 17 (01) :37-45
[7]  
Ferretti G., 2000, Proceedings 2000 ICRA. Millennium Conference. IEEE International Conference on Robotics and Automation. Symposia Proceedings (Cat. No.00CH37065), P4027, DOI 10.1109/ROBOT.2000.845359
[8]  
HASHTRUDIZAAD K, 2000, THESIS U BRIT COL DE
[9]   IMPEDANCE CONTROL - AN APPROACH TO MANIPULATION .1. THEORY [J].
HOGAN, N .
JOURNAL OF DYNAMIC SYSTEMS MEASUREMENT AND CONTROL-TRANSACTIONS OF THE ASME, 1985, 107 (01) :1-7
[10]  
JOHNANSSON R, 1994, P IEEE INT C ROB AUT, P616